Wo was elected georgia's first governor under the constitution of 1777?

John Adam Treutlen was the first governor of Georgia elected in 1777. He took a break from statewide politic when he was proceeded by the newly elected governor John Houstoun, in January 1778.

What is Pennsylvania's plan of government?

It operates under its fifth Constitution (1968) with a seperately elected Governor and Lieutenant Governor, a bicameral General Assembly with a 50 member Senate and 203 Representatives and an elected Judiciary.
